Tech Used:

Video Recording/Editing: Virtual Dub
Capture: Diamond VC500 Capture Card
Voice: Audacity
Cobbling the video and voice together: ArcSoft Showbiz

I don't have an external microphone or a headset, so that's why there's the slight echo (The Audacity recording picks up the game slightly as well), but I tried my best to minimize it.

There also may be some discrepancy between the Voice and the video/sound. Virtual Dub gives me some crazy desync like you wouldn't believe, you should have heard the out of sync game audio before I messed with it. Again, I tried the best I could. As for my voice, I took crapshoots at ligning the voice track with the video and got it pretty close. I need a better way to line 'em up...

I have aquired Camtasia since this recording, which I shall use instead of Audacity and ArcSoft Showbiz. ArcSoft really sucks, and while Audacity is fine, using Camtasia's onboard microphone will be a lot easier, as my voice will be synced up with the game and the game audio shouldn't desync.
